Abstract

The utility model discloses a wastewater filtering device which comprises a filtering device main body, a conveying pipe is mounted above the filtering device main body, a gravel activated carbon filtering material is placed below the filtering device main body, a supporting mechanism is fixedly mounted on the inner wall of the filtering device main body, and a placing mechanism is placed above the supporting mechanism; a filtering mechanism is placed in the placing mechanism, and a limiting mechanism is fixed above the placing mechanism. Waste water can be conveyed into the filtering device main body through the conveying pipe, the waste water can be filtered through the gravel activated carbon filtering material, when the waste water passes through the multiple sets of filtering net plates, large impurities in the waste water can be filtered and separated, the filtering effect of the gravel activated carbon filtering material is improved, and meanwhile through the containing frame and the supporting block, the waste water can be conveniently filtered. And the multiple sets of filter screen plates can be conveniently placed in an auxiliary mode, and the supporting mechanism can limit and support the whole containing frame.

Description

TECHNICAL FIELD

[0001] The utility model relates to wastewater filtering technical field especially, relates to a wastewater filtering device. BACKGROUND

[0002] Wastewater refers to the water and runoff rainwater that are discharged in the process of resident activity, including domestic sewage, industrial wastewater and initial rain runoff into drainage pipe and other useless water, wastewater usually refers to the water that cannot be recycled or is treated after primary pollution and the treatment difficulty reaches certain standard, and filtration is an important step of wastewater treatment.

[0003] The existing wastewater filtering device will inject wastewater into the device and carry out preliminary filtration through the sand and activated carbon in the device when in use, but the wastewater contains large-particle garbage impurities, which increases the filtration strength of the sand and activated carbon and affects the service life, therefore, the wastewater filtering device is provided to solve the above problems. UTILITY MODEL CONTENT

[0004] The utility model discloses a wastewater filtering device that aims at solving the shortcomings in the prior art.

[0005] In order to achieve the above-mentioned purpose, the utility model adopts the following technical scheme:

[0006] A wastewater filtering device, comprising a filtering device main body, a conveying pipe is installed above the filtering device main body, sand and activated carbon filter material is placed below the filtering device main body, a supporting mechanism is fixedly installed on the inner wall of the filtering device main body, a placing mechanism is placed above the supporting mechanism, a filtering mechanism is placed in the placing mechanism, and a limiting mechanism is fixed above the placing mechanism.

[0007] Preferably, the supporting mechanism comprises a connecting column, the inner wall of the filtering device main body is fixedly connected with a mounting frame through the connecting column, a guide wheel is installed in the mounting frame, and the mounting frame can be assisted and supported through the connecting column.

[0008] Preferably, the placing mechanism comprises a placing frame, the placing frame is in contact with the upper surface of the guide wheel, a plurality of groups of through holes are formed in the inner wall of the placing frame, a plurality of groups of supporting blocks are fixedly connected with the inner wall of the through holes, and the filter screen plate can be assisted and supported through the supporting blocks.

[0009] Preferably, the filtering mechanism comprises a filter screen plate, the filter screen plate is placed above the supporting blocks, and the surface size of the filter screen plate is matched with the inner wall size of the through hole, so that the wastewater can be filtered through the filter screen plate.

[0010] Preferably, the upper fixed connection of the filter screen plate is provided with a fixed column, and the upper fixed connection of the fixed column is provided with a fixed block, which can facilitate the taking of the filter screen plate.

[0011] Preferably, the limiting mechanism comprises a support column, the upper fixed connection of the placing frame is provided with a support column, and the upper fixed connection of the support column is provided with a fixed plate, a rotating screw column is screwed in the fixed plate, and the rotating screw column can be moved in the fixed plate by rotating the rotating screw column, thereby facilitating the limiting of the filter screen plate.

[0012] Preferably, the lower fixed connection of the rotating screw column is provided with a pressing plate, and the pressing plate is disc-shaped, which can increase the pressing stability of the pressing plate.

[0013] Compared with the prior art, the beneficial effects of the utility model are:

[0014] 1. The device can convey wastewater into the filter device main body through the conveying pipe, filter the wastewater through the sand and activated carbon filter material, filter and separate larger impurities in the wastewater when the wastewater passes through the multiple filter screen plates, improve the filtering effect of the sand and activated carbon filter material, conveniently place the multiple filter screen plates through the placing frame and the supporting block, and support the placing frame as a whole through the supporting mechanism.

[0015] 2. The device can rotate the rotating screw column to move the rotating screw column along the fixed plate, press the pressing plate on the surface of the filter screen plate, conveniently limit and install the filter screen plate, and conveniently take the filter screen plate through the fixed column and the fixed block. [0025] The technical solutions in the embodiments of the utility model will be clearly and completely described below with reference to the drawings in the embodiments of the utility model. Obviously, the described embodiments are only part of the embodiments of the utility model, not all the embodiments.

[0026] Referring to Figures 1-4 A wastewater filter device, comprising a filter device body 1, a conveying pipe 2 is installed above the filter device body 1, a sandstone activated carbon filter material 3 is placed below the filter device body 1, a support mechanism 4 is fixedly installed on the inner wall of the filter device body 1, and a placing mechanism 5 is placed above the support mechanism 4, the support mechanism 4 can conveniently rotate the whole placing mechanism 5, conveniently disassemble and clean a plurality of filter mechanisms 6, the filter mechanism 6 is placed in the inside of the placing mechanism 5, and a limiting mechanism 7 is fixed above the placing mechanism 5.

[0027] Further, referring to Figure 2 And Figure 3 It can be known that the support mechanism 4 comprises a connecting column 41, the inner wall of the filter device body 1 is fixedly connected with a mounting frame 42 through the connecting column 41, a guide wheel 43 is installed in the inside of the mounting frame 42, and the placing frame 51 can be guided to rotate through the rotation of the guide wheel 43 in the inside of the mounting frame 42.

[0028] Further, referring to Figure 2 And Figure 4 It can be known that the placing mechanism 5 comprises a placing frame 51, the placing frame 51 is in contact with the upper side of the guide wheel 43, a plurality of through holes are formed in the inside of the placing frame 51, a support block 52 is fixedly connected to the inner wall of the plurality of through holes, and the filter screen plate 61 can be conveniently installed through the plurality of through holes formed in the inside of the placing frame 51.

[0029] Further, referring to Figure 2 And Figure 4It can be known that the filtering mechanism 6 comprises a filter screen plate 61, the filter screen plate 61 is placed above the supporting block 52, and the surface size of the filter screen plate 61 is matched with the inner wall size of the through hole.

[0030] Further, referring to Figure 2 and Figure 4 It can be known that the filter screen plate 61 is fixedly connected with a fixed column 62 above, and the fixed column 62 is fixedly connected with a fixed block 63 above, and the fixed column 62 and the fixed block 63 can be conveniently taken out.

[0031] Further, referring to Figure 2 and Figure 4 It can be known that the limiting mechanism 7 comprises a supporting column 71, the supporting column 71 is fixedly connected above the placing frame 51, and the supporting column 71 is fixedly connected with a fixed plate 72 above, and a rotating screw column 73 is screwed in the fixed plate 72, and the rotating screw column 73 can be moved along the fixed plate 72 by rotating the rotating screw column 73, so as to limit the function of the filter screen plate 61.

[0032] Further, referring to Figure 2 and Figure 4 It can be known that the rotating screw column 73 is fixedly connected with a pressing plate 74 below, and the pressing plate 74 is provided in a disc shape, and the filter screen plate 61 is pressed on the surface of the filter screen plate 61 by the pressing plate 74, so as to conveniently limit the filter screen plate 61.

[0033] Working principle: when the filtering device main body 1 is used, according to the attached Figure 1 , the attached Figure 2 , the attached Figure 3 and the attached Figure 4 , the wastewater can be injected into the filtering device main body 1 through the conveying pipe 2, and the wastewater can be filtered through the filter screen plate 61, so as to be filtered through the sand and activated carbon filter material 3 for multiple times, when the filter screen plate 61 needs to be cleaned, the manhole on the surface of the filtering device main body 1 is opened, the rotating screw column 73 is rotated, the pressing plate 74 is away from the surface of the filter screen plate 61, at this time, the filter screen plate 61 is taken out from the placing frame 51 by means of the auxiliary tool and the fixed column 62 and the fixed block 63, and the placing frame 51 is rotated along the surface of the guide wheel 43 by means of the auxiliary tool and the fixed column 62 and the fixed block 63, so as to take out and clean the multiple filter screen plates 61 in turn.
